Description

A fantastic location. An historic house with a wealth of associations. Dating from c. 1640, the house was modernised in 1676 and then again in 1723. We have been here since 1999. A great stepping off point, whether you are going to London, The Cotswolds, Bristol, Bath, Cheltenham etc. We are very near to the Motorway network, 2 Railway Stations (Bristol Temple Meads or Bristol Parkway), Bristol Airport, Coach station in Bristol. Locally there are quality Pubs, Indian and Chinese eateries. The space The Annexe is a recently converted ex-agricultural building, in other lives it has been used for animal shelter, pigs, as a hay barn and to keep chickens at night. It is cosy, warm and inviting space. With underfloor heating, quality King Sized double bed, Wet Room, fully fitted Kitchen and large Lounge. TV' s in both the Lounge and Bedroom. Please NOTE, this is a listed building, as such it has a steep staircase - (not a ladder, like some Dutch property)! Quite steep never-the-less. Guest access We can usually provide off street parking through farm gate. We will explain where to park when you arrive as this is a shared area and we want to make sure we do not block our neighbour's access. Other things to note Moorend is in an ideal location as a stepping off point; near the M4, M5, M32, A38 and many more. Whether you want to go to the Cotswolds, Bath, Bristol, or the Badmington horse trials - Or up on the train to London for Wimbledon, Harrod's, Tate Modern. They are all just under 2 hours away on the train. Bristol is one the UK's most popular tourist destinations, whether for food, shopping, culture or just to relax. Don't forget the Clifton suspension bridge, Banksy and the SS Great Britain.
